I’m sure I’ve seen this mentioned before on here - but can’t find outcome. I’ve just copied a route from Basecamp to my Nav VI. Distance shows the same but route time is very different on Nav?

Both Basecamp and Nav have same map version. Profile settings are the same on both too. Time always shows less on Nav. ( Maybe my Nav knows I just don’t stop for pee breaks 😂)

Any thoughts appreciated as to why it would be different.

Within the activity profiles on Basecamp there is a slider called 'Custom Speed' where you can adjust the default speed which I assume will affect the forecast journey time. Don't think there is an equivalent on the Nav, so maybe that is the cause of the difference.
 
their algorithms are written by different chimps and make different assumptions about your speed on a particular road.

By default, they are different, Wessie is right, but then you can make further adjustments in Basecamp, which I have done as I always found that I was planning routes in Basecamp that seemed reasonable in terms of time, but then in reality on the Nav they would take much longer. My slider is at -10mph as a result to stop me biting off more than I can chew.

Just checked a recent 78 mile loop, Nav says 1h50m, Basecamp with -10mph adjustment says 2h13m, with zero adjustment says 1h55m.....
